This report analyzed 2 schools in Louisiana to see which ones offered the best value associate degree programs for mechanic & repair technologies students. The goal was to highlight schools with more affordable prices than others offering similar quality experiences.

This ranking is not just a list of inexpensive schools. We also consider each school's quality, since we believe a low-quality school may not be a 'bargain' at any price. More specifically, we discount our quality score by the published tuition and fees charged by a school. This gives the cost per unit of quality for each college. The value is determined by how much quality your dollar buys.

For nationwide and regional rankings, we use out-of-state tuition and fees in our calculations. Average in-state tuition and fees are used for our statewide rankings.

Delgado Community College

New Orleans, LA

Our 2023 rankings named Delgado Community College the best value school in Louisiana for mechanic & repair technologies students working on their associate degree. Delgado Community College is a large public school located in the large city of New Orleans.

In-state tuition fees for undergraduate students at Delgado Community College are $4,679 per year.

The excellent associate degree programs at South Louisiana Community College helped the school earn the #2 place on this year’s ranking of the best value mechanic & repair technologies schools in Louisiana. South Louisiana Community College is a medium-sized public school located in the medium-sized city of Lafayette.

The average tuition and fees for an in-state undergraduate at South Louisiana Community College are $4,205 a year.
